Tryon bills itself as "The Friendliest Town in the South." It's located in Polk County southeast of Asheville along U.S. Highway 176 near the North Pacolet River. This is the central Blue Ridge Mountains and Foothills area, known for its' mild climate due to the "thermal belt," where it's cooler in the summer and warmer in the winter. This allows for year round outdoor activities and recreation. Tryon has become a premier retirement town and has been listed as "one of the top ten retirement communities" by Money Magazine. It's also been known for its' equestrian pursuits for over fifty years. The Tryon Riding and Hunt Club and FENCE (Foothills Equestrian Nature Center,) host several events each year from March through early December, including the annual Block House Steeplechase Races, usually held in April. Lake Adger, located near Tryon, is a 438-acre lake with over 14 miles of unspoiled shoreline. The Lake Adger Trails Equestrian and Nature path meanders peacefully around the lake and a series of small, private communities are situated around the natural landscape of the lake. Several streams in and around Polk County near the town of Tryon offer fishing for brook, brown and rainbow trout, and other activities include rafting and tubing, hiking, camping and golf. Other places of interest include the city of Columbus, which is the county seat and historic Saluda, home to the steepest standard gauge railroad in the country. The downtown district of Saluda is on the National Register of Historic Places.

Tryon Weather & Climate

The foothills near Asheville, has a climate that is often hard to predict, but can generally be called mild. The elevation of the region is about 2,200 feet. Temperatures are warmer in winter than the High Country, and cooler in summer than the low lying areas and Piedmont Region. Spring has mild days and cool nights with some rainy days. Summer is warm and humid with scattered afternoon thunderstorms, but temperatures rarely rise above 90 degrees. Conditions cool down a little by October, but days are still warm and nights are cool. It's perfect weather for viewing the spectacular fall foliage. In winter, the high mountains protect the area and there is seldom a major snowfall. Highs even in the middle of winter range in the 40s and 50s.

Tryon Map & Transportation

The closest airports in the area are the Greenville Spartanburg International airport (GSP) located about 21 miles south of Tryon in Greer, South Carolina, the Asheville Regional airport (AVL) located approximately 23 miles northwest of Tryon in Asheville, North Carolina, the Donaldson Center airport (GYH) located roughly 32 miles northwest of Tryon in Greenville, South Carolina, and finally the Charlotte Douglas International airport (CLT) located around 73 miles east of Tryon in Charlotte, North Carolina.
